How can an individual turn a negative customer interaction into a positive experience to leave a lasting impression and build customer loyalty?
An individual can turn a negative customer interaction into a positive experience by actively listening to the customer's concerns, empathizing with their situation, and taking ownership of the issue to find a solution. By offering a sincere apology and providing a resolution that exceeds the customer's expectations, the individual can demonstrate their commitment to customer satisfaction. Following up with the customer to ensure their satisfaction and showing appreciation for their feedback can help build trust and loyalty for future interactions.
